This book highlights the importance of the concept of 'form' (formality) from the perspective of comparative law. It discusses formality in contemporary law through several principles and ideas, such as the principle of consent and the promise of a formal contract. The book presents formality within a historical dimension, addressing it in Islamic jurisprudence and among pre-Islamic Arabs. It seeks to present form as a cornerstone of contract formation and verbal formalism according to various intellectual and religious schools of thought, like the Shafi'is and Ibn Hazm. It also covers non-verbal formalities such as witnessing, the formality of receipt in Islamic jurisprudence, constitutive notification, and refined formalities like verbal expression as a means of conveying intent.

The book concludes by presenting theories such as the theory of verbalism in the Syrian Personal Status Law, the theory of apparent will in Islamic jurisprudence, the theory of the contract session (majlis al-'aqd) in Islamic jurisprudence and the Hanafi, Maliki, Hanbali, and Ibadi schools, and the theory of the contract session in the Syrian Civil Code.

Notably, the book adopts an objective, historical, and comparative research methodology, as it primarily relies on textual sources.
